Output d84df15c91eebe1087f09fabd429e478853fedd9755ecfb952f876f5d0714c30:0

value
22853381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29dc642192bbb2cf88da92689c240fe817415914 OP_EQUALVERIFY OP_CHECKSIG
address
14pLiumJbDQujpoABUYvdygLxJK9UqLy4Z
transaction
d84df15c91eebe1087f09fabd429e478853fedd9755ecfb952f876f5d0714c30
confirmations
385788
spent
true